The Professor's I've had are amazing. Their very supportive of all the students & eager to assist you if have trouble with anything. just ask. Send them a quick email, ask your questions, & that is all it takes. Don't be afraid to ask. The online classes are fairly simple. Technically called, "Asynchronous Learning" which means it can be taken up in your own time & allows you to have more flexibility. Each term is 7.5 week's. Wednesdays are discussion post deadline's& Saturday nights, is the deadline for all the other assignments, for the week. The only thing I wished this college didn't do, was some of the admissions are a little deceitful with tuition. They backed me into a corner & pressured me into signing up for loans that I absolutely did not want & couldn't afford. They knew my situation up front & yet I ended up with 4 loans, & I can't repay. I felt like I had no other choice. (Expctd grad date: 4/2023) just be careful of any college admissions like that type. Say no.
